Holiday Inn Express & Suites against its category
The biggest tracked US hotels chains by card spend, with year-over-year growth of category share. Share means a chain's slice of tracked category spend. It can decline while the chain's own sales grow. The chart tracks Holiday Inn Express & Suites's share of the category quarter by quarter, indexed to 2024 Q1 = 100.
